JR Farm Grainless Drops Carrot for Rodents & Rabbits

JR Farm Grainless Drops Carrot are small, crunchy reward drops for rodents and rabbits. The drops are grain-free and made with pea flakes, carrot, and rapeseed oil. Their handy size makes them easy to give as a snack, reward, or small foraging treat.

These carrot drops are especially great for owners looking for a grain-free snack that is easy to portion. You can feed a drop by hand, use it during taming, or hide it in a food bowl. Usage & dosage

Give JR Farm Grainless Drops Carrot as an additional snack. You can give a drop by hand, offer it in a food bowl, or use it as a small reward during taming, training, or bonding moments.

Do you want to use the drops for foraging? Then hide a few drops in different places in the enclosure, in a snuffle mat, treat roll, foraging tray, or in the hay. This way, your animal has to search, and a snack time immediately becomes a small activity.

For small animals, one drop or a small number of drops is often sufficient. For larger animals, you can dose slightly more generously, but keep it supplementary. Check leftovers regularly and remove any material that has become damp or dirty.

Compound

Pea flakes, carrots 42.3%, rapeseed oil.

Analytical constituents

Crude protein 13.1%, crude fat 6.4%, crude fiber 4.4%, crude ash 2.8%, calcium 1000 mg/kg, phosphorus 2900 mg/kg, sodium 830 mg/kg.

What does this compound mean?

The composition is straightforward and grain-free: pea flakes as a base, supplemented with carrot and rapeseed oil. Carrot gives the drops their recognizable vegetable variety and makes them appealing as a small reward or snack.

The analysis corresponds to a crunchy vegetable drop with a plant-based formula. Use the drops as a snack and not as a main food. The small size makes dosing easy and allows you to tailor the amount to your animal.
